Before choosing a tuition centre, it is important to assess your child's needs. Is your child struggling with a specific subject or does he/she need help with homework? Once you identify the areas where your child needs support, you can look for a tuition centre that specializes in those subjects or areas.
The quality of the teachers at the tuition centre is critical to your child's success. Look for a tuition centre that employs qualified and experienced teachers who know how to teach the subject matter effectively. Check the qualifications and experience of the teachers before enrolling your child in a tuition centre.
The size of the class is also an important factor to consider. Smaller class sizes often provide more individual attention and support for each student. This can be especially important if your child has learning difficulties or needs more personalized attention.
The teaching methodology used by the tuition centre is another important consideration. Look for a tuition centre that uses innovative and effective teaching methods that cater to different learning styles. A good tuition centre will provide individualized attention and adapt its teaching methods to the needs of the students.
The location and facilities of the tuition centre are also important factors to consider. Choose a tuition centre that is conveniently located and easily accessible. The facilities should also be conducive to learning and provide a comfortable and safe environment for your child.
The fees charged by the tuition centre should be reasonable and affordable. Look for a tuition centre that offers flexible payment options and discounts for long-term enrolment. Make sure you understand all the fees involved and choose a tuition centre that fits your budget.
Choosing the best tuition centre for your child requires careful consideration of several key factors. By assessing your child's needs, checking the credentials of the teachers, considering the size of the class, reviewing the teaching methodology, evaluating the location and facilities, and comparing fees and payment options, you can find the best tuition centre that will help your child succeed in school.
